Output 588863be18f3027840fbb0f4b495dc174afa4bbeaf7717ef0d14e95c1b395482:1

value
539683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87e13694263b3cd71f19272dda23c98327aa58b8 OP_EQUAL
address
3E5UwXb6La3BAtGL4ddnPY5KpvW47LScDs
transaction
588863be18f3027840fbb0f4b495dc174afa4bbeaf7717ef0d14e95c1b395482
confirmations
250794
spent
true